Heading for Jerusalem

' Because the Lord God helps me, I will not be dismayed, therefore I have set my face like flint to do his will, and I have known that I will triumph.' Isaiah 50: 7 (TLB)
We know God helps us because he is on our side, so why do we dismay?
How blessed are we to be in a situation where we can know this right to the core of our heart, that God is always present, always in what we do in his name. We sometimes say in tricky situations: Grit your teeth and get on with it, or bite the bullet and just do it! I like this great sense of determination from Isaiah.................'I will set my face like flint to do his will.'
When we have the problems of 'dismay' in our days we have the promise of God's help so whatever it is today, go for it, God will be there.
